Overview of Reclaim AI

Reclaim uses AI to analyze your work habits and automatically schedule flexible task blocks around meetings and personal time. It prioritizes tasks dynamically—moving them when conflicts arise—and helps plan recurring habits like workouts or reading. Its predictive algorithms adapt week by week based on your behavior. Integrations with Todoist, Asana, and Slack allow automatic syncing of tasks. Analytics dashboards visualize focus time vs. meeting load, helping teams rebalance workloads. For remote teams, it’s like having a personal time strategist that runs silently in the background.

How to use Reclaim AI

Connect your Google Calendar and set your working hours. Add tasks or sync from your project manager. Assign priority, due date, and duration; Reclaim will auto-schedule blocks accordingly. Adjust rules for flexibility (e.g., reschedule if a meeting overlaps). Use the Slack integration to see your AI-adjusted schedule and mark focus sessions.
